Job Description Job Description Description: Seeking a dedicated
Electro-Optic Support Specialist to provide hands-on technical
support at the EOSF in MCSC Quantico. This key personnel role
focuses on testing, maintenance, and operational support for
optical systems, supporting quarterly testing requirements (two
systems per quarter with multiple tests). The position ensures
facility readiness, inventory accuracy, and compliance with DoD
standards in a secure environment. Key Responsibilities
Electro-Optical System Testing and Surveillance : Perform testing,
surveillance, and troubleshooting of day optical systems, image
intensification systems, laser systems, and thermal systems.
Maintenance and Upkeep : Conduct maintenance management and test
equipment upkeep to maintain operational integrity. Test
Development : Assist in developing test plans and methods for
optical systems. Inventory and Accountability : Maintain inventory
control and proper accountability documentation for all EOSF
equipment. Data Analysis and Evaluations : Provide technical
analysis of test results, process data, and participate in limited
user evaluations. Logistics Support : Support government shipping
of equipment to/from EOSF, ensuring secure handling. SOP Compliance
: Ensure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) for the EOSF are
maintained, updated, and followed. Quarterly Output : Support
testing of approximately two systems every quarter, each involving
several tests. Requirements: Required Skills & Experience Education
: Associate's or Bachelor's degree in Electronics, Optics,
Engineering Technology, or related field (or equivalent
experience). Experience : 3 years in electro-optical systems
support, including testing, troubleshooting, and maintenance.
Hands-on work with optical technologies (day optics, I2, lasers,
thermals). Experience in inventory management and test plan
development in DoD settings. Skills and Competencies : Technical
proficiency in system testing and data processing. Strong attention
to detail for accountability and SOP adherence. Ability to handle
physical equipment and logistics tasks. Certifications : Relevant
technical certifications (e.g., in optics or electronics).
Additional Requirements U.S. Citizenship required Active Secret
